One of the primary benefits of implementing a procurement system is the ability to centralize and automate the entire procurement process. By utilizing a cloud-based software solution, organizations can efficiently manage their sourcing, procurement, and contract management activities in one centralized platform. This allows for greater visibility and control over the entire procurement lifecycle, leading to increased efficiency and reduced cycle times.

In addition to centralization and automation, procurement systems also provide organizations with access to critical data and analytics that can inform strategic decision-making. With real-time insights into spending patterns, supplier performance, and contract compliance, businesses can proactively identify opportunities for cost savings and process improvements. This data-driven approach to procurement not only enables organizations to optimize their supply chain operations but also enhances collaboration with suppliers and stakeholders.

Furthermore, the integration of artificial intelligence and machine learning capabilities into procurement systems has revolutionized the way businesses approach supplier management and risk mitigation. By leveraging advanced analytics and predictive modeling, organizations can identify potential risks and opportunities before they arise, allowing them to proactively address issues and minimize disruptions in the supply chain. This proactive approach not only enhances operational resilience but also strengthens relationships with suppliers and fosters a culture of trust and transparency.

Another key benefit of modern procurement systems is the ability to enhance compliance and governance measures within the organization. By implementing standardized processes and workflows, businesses can ensure that all procurement activities adhere to regulatory guidelines and industry best practices. This not only mitigates the risk of non-compliance but also enhances transparency and accountability across the organization.

Moreover, procurement systems enable organizations to streamline their supplier relationships and optimize sourcing strategies for improved performance and cost savings. By consolidating supplier data and performance metrics in a centralized platform, businesses can easily identify opportunities for supplier consolidation, renegotiate contracts, and leverage volume discounts for greater savings. This strategic approach to supplier management not only drives down costs but also enhances supplier relationships and fosters a culture of collaboration and innovation.
